为保证压力容器、压力管道安全,稳定地运行,检验机构必须做好压力容器、压力管道的安装监督检验与定期检验工作。然而现在的多数设备都带有覆盖层,为了对其进行厚度测量与表面、内部缺陷的检测就必须停机,拆除覆盖层,这样势必会带来不小的人力、物力的损耗与经济损失。本文介绍了几种比较先进的无损检测技术及其在带有覆盖层的压力容器、压力管道上的应用,如:脉冲涡流检测技术、声发射检测技术、红外热成像检测技术、超声导波检测技术等等,然而这些无损检测技术还并不是非常成熟,有些也未得到广泛的应用,存在着一些未解决的难题,但是其无可比拟的优点将使之成为无损检测行业发展的必然趋势,文中对上述的问题进行了阐述。

It is essential to wonderfully complete the work of supervision inspection and periodic inspection for inspection agency to ensure the safe and stable operation for pressure vessels and pressure pipelines. However most equipments are covered with coating nowadays, in order to measure thickness and inspect the surface and internal defects, the machines must be halted as well as the coating be removed,which will inevitably lead to great loss of manpower ,material resources and economy. Several new technologies of NDT and its application on pressure vessel and pressure pipeline with coating were discussed in this paper, such as Pulsed eddy current testing technology, acoustic emission test, infrared thermal imaging detection technology, X-ray real-time imaging detection technology, etc.While most of these are not so mature and have not been applied widely, some problems also remain unsovled, but its incomparable advantages will make it the inevitable tendency of the development of nondestructive testing industry, issues above were introduced in this paper.
